Phylogenetic analysis of the amino acid sequence of the hydrophobic domains of the Cpn 1054 gene family obtained from C. pneumoniae CWL029. Hydrophobic domains of Cpn186, 284, 285, 829, and 830 are included in this figure as outliers. The outliers represent candidate Inc proteins that contain a bilobed hydrophobic domain similar to that encoded by Cpn 1054 gene family members, but that share no obvious amino acid similarity with family members. Multiple sequence alignments were performed and analyzed using CLUSTALW and PAUP* programs. Distance matrices were inferred by neighbor-joining to estimate evolutionary distances. Bootstrap values (based on 1000 replicates) are represented at each node. Scale bar indicates 0.1 change per nucleotide.
